LS11 SEAFOOD SAVVY
Thursdays, 10:45 a.m. - 12:15 p.m.
Dates: 5 sessions, October 16 - November 13
Instructor: Doris Hicks
Held at Cannon Lab, Rm 104, College of Marine and Earth
Studies Campus in Lewes
Seafood Savvy will provide students
with the latest information about eyeing and buying
and preparing fish and shellfish. We will cover the
role of seafood in the diet along with all the latest
information about the risk, and benefits of eating seafood.
New preparation techniques along with some past favorites
will be presented. Additional fee of $6.00 to cover
supplies. Class limited to 25 students.

LS40 FINANCIAL WORKSHOP FOR
INDIVIDUAL INVESTORS
Thursdays, 9:00 a.m. - 10:30 a.m.
Dates: 5 sessions, October 16 - November 13
Instructor: Derek Clifton
Five-week course beginning with the
basics of stock and fixed income investments, asset
allocation, and risk tolerance. The middle of the course
focuses on money issues that arise in retirement, making
smart choices in retirement, and managing retirement
income. The final session covers estate planning and
charitable giving. Class limited to 12 students.
